Nnenna broke into uncontrollable sobs as the doctor placed the baby in her arms. She gripped her husband’s arm tightly while he stood by her side beaming with pride; his second child had finally arrived.
“She won’t forgive us” Nnenna cried “How can we do this?”
“What do you mean?” Cheta asked confused
“With all that has happened Cheta, how can we justify bringing another child into this world?”
Cheta looked into her eyes and felt her pain. He suddenly realized the mistake he had made. He remembered the children that had suffered, the children that had died, the children that no one cared about…,
Tears rolled down his cheeks.
He remembered the bill.
This bill…
“The Senate on Wednesday passed the Sexual Offences Bill, 2015 which prescribes life imprisonment for rapists and those who have sexual intercourse with children under 11 years”
Why 11?!
What happens to children under 16? Who will fight for them?
And these murders…
“Over 20 Travelling UNN Students Die In Car Accident”

“69 Killed in Tanker Explosion in Nigeria”
We have become so individualistic and emotionally dead that we neglect to recognize the depth of a lost child when we are not directly affected.
In recent times, there have been a number of tanker “accidents” and nobody is questioning or investigating these murders.
Fuel scarcity, fuel hike and all of a sudden series of tanker explosions.
Is it OK for marketers to put tankers on the road with the awareness that the vehicles are not road worthy?
Where is our road safety when you need them most?
Let me guess…
Questioning the road worthiness of new vehicles and expensive cars that can produce huge fines.
To a mother who loses a child, one is more than a thousand. So think of this, for every death there is someone out there who feels the pain of a thousand deaths.
Don’t say nothing can be done. Something CAN be done. Someone IS responsible. Such “accidents” CAN and SHOULD be avoided.
If these deaths are not investigated, if the people responsible are not punished….
Then the government and the people are saying it is okay to put the lives of millions of people at risk and it is definitely okay to kill people in cold blood.
If this bill is not modified, then the government and the people are saying it is okay to molest 12, 13, 14, and 15 year old children.
Tell me, why won’t a mother bring her child into NIGERIA with tears in her eyes?
May the souls of the departed rest in peace.
